Letter text
Jan 17th 1778
Sir
The inclosed [sic] Resolutions of Congress appearing to contain Matters proper for the Consideration of the general Assembly, I have taken the Liberty to send them to you, I am
Sir You obedient & very Humble Servant
P. HENRY[1]
